March Rainfall and Precipitation in Hungary

Monthly rainfall totals, rainy days and the driest cities across Hungary in March.

Hungary experiences in March precipitation ranging from a moderate 39 mm (1.5 in) in Jászapáti to a moderate 57 mm (2.2 in) in Barcs.

Hungary precipitation in March: frequently asked questions

How much rainfall does Hungary receive in March?

Budapest stays mostly dry in March, with average rainfall close to 42 mm (1.7 in).

How many days does it rain in Hungary in March?

On average, Budapest has about 11 days days of rain in March.

Is March part of the rainy season in Hungary?

March is generally a drier month for Hungary, falling outside the main rainy season.

What is the wettest city in March in Hungary?

Looking at our data, Barcs tops the wettest-cities list in Hungary for March, with monthly rainfall averaging 57 mm (2.2 in).

What is the driest city in March in Hungary?

The driest place is Jászapáti with an average rainfall of 39 mm (1.5 in) according to our data.
